It’s tough being a youngin at the gym
Gyms can sometimes feel intimidating, especially for younger individuals who might feel judged by more experienced gym-goers. It's not uncommon to encounter some disapproving stares when you're new or just trying to explore your preferences. However, recognizing that everyone was a beginner at some point can help ease these feelings. Consider creating a fitness plan tailored to your goals—whether it's weight loss, building muscle, or simply improving overall health. Engaging with fitness communities online can also provide support and motivation. Communities are increasingly becoming accessible via social media platforms where you can connect with individuals facing similar challenges. Don't hesitate to ask questions or seek advice from more seasoned members who can provide insights and encouragement. Remember, fitness is a personal journey where progress takes time, and each visit to the gym is a step toward your goals. Embrace the learning process and celebrate small victories along the way.
